Home
last modified time | relevance | path

Searched refs:pktlen (Results 1 – 25 of 94) sorted by relevance

1234

/freebsd/sys/dev/usb/net/
H A Dif_cdceem.c323 uint16_t pktlen; in cdceem_handle_cmd() local
338 pktlen = hdr & CDCEEM_ECHO_LEN_MASK; in cdceem_handle_cmd()
339 CDCEEM_DEBUG(sc, "received Echo, length %d", pktlen); in cdceem_handle_cmd()
341 if (pktlen > (actlen - off)) { in cdceem_handle_cmd()
344 pktlen, actlen - off); in cdceem_handle_cmd()
348 if (pktlen > sizeof(sc->sc_echo_buffer)) { in cdceem_handle_cmd()
351 pktlen, sizeof(sc->sc_echo_buffer)); in cdceem_handle_cmd()
356 sc->sc_echo_len = pktlen; in cdceem_handle_cmd()
357 usbd_copy_out(pc, off, sc->sc_echo_buffer, pktlen); in cdceem_handle_cmd()
358 off += pktlen; in cdceem_handle_cmd()
[all …]
H A Dif_smsc.c956 int pktlen; in smsc_bulk_read_callback() local
989 pktlen = (uint16_t)SMSC_RX_STAT_FRM_LENGTH(rxhdr); in smsc_bulk_read_callback()
992 "off %d\n", rxhdr, pktlen, actlen, off); in smsc_bulk_read_callback()
1002 if ((pktlen < ETHER_HDR_LEN) || (pktlen > (actlen - off))) in smsc_bulk_read_callback()
1012 if (pktlen > m->m_len) { in smsc_bulk_read_callback()
1014 pktlen, m->m_len); in smsc_bulk_read_callback()
1019 usbd_copy_out(pc, off, mtod(m, uint8_t *), pktlen); in smsc_bulk_read_callback()
1028 pktlen -= 2; in smsc_bulk_read_callback()
1041 (pktlen > ETHER_MIN_LEN)) { in smsc_bulk_read_callback()
1054 usbd_copy_out(pc, (off + pktlen), in smsc_bulk_read_callback()
[all …]
H A Dif_muge.c1168 int pktlen; in muge_bulk_read_callback() local
1220 pktlen = (rx_cmd_a & RX_CMD_A_LEN_MASK_); in muge_bulk_read_callback()
1224 " pktlen %d actlen %d off %d\n", in muge_bulk_read_callback()
1225 rx_cmd_a, rx_cmd_b, rx_cmd_c, pktlen, actlen, off); in muge_bulk_read_callback()
1233 if ((pktlen < ETHER_HDR_LEN) || in muge_bulk_read_callback()
1234 (pktlen > (actlen - off))) in muge_bulk_read_callback()
1246 if (pktlen > m->m_len) { in muge_bulk_read_callback()
1249 pktlen, m->m_len); in muge_bulk_read_callback()
1255 pktlen); in muge_bulk_read_callback()
1280 if (pktlen > ETHER_MIN_LE in muge_bulk_read_callback()
[all...]
/freebsd/sys/net80211/
H A Dieee80211_rssadapt.c221 bucket(int pktlen) in bucket() argument
229 if (pktlen <= top) in bucket()
239 u_int pktlen = iarg; in rssadapt_rate() local
257 thrs = &ra->ra_rate_thresh[bucket(pktlen)]; in rssadapt_rate()
271 ni->ni_txrate, pktlen, rssi); in rssadapt_rate()
283 rssadapt_lower_rate(struct ieee80211_rssadapt_node *ra, int pktlen, int rssi) in rssadapt_lower_rate() argument
289 thrs = &ra->ra_rate_thresh[bucket(pktlen)]; in rssadapt_lower_rate()
303 rssadapt_raise_rate(struct ieee80211_rssadapt_node *ra, int pktlen, int rssi) in rssadapt_raise_rate() argument
309 thrs = &ra->ra_rate_thresh[bucket(pktlen)]; in rssadapt_raise_rate()
335 int pktlen, rssi; in rssadapt_tx_complete() local
[all …]
/freebsd/sys/dev/rtwn/pci/
H A Drtwn_pci_rx.c93 int infosz, pktlen, shift, error; in rtwn_pci_rx_frame() local
116 pktlen = MS(rxdw0, RTWN_RXDW0_PKTLEN); in rtwn_pci_rx_frame()
117 if (__predict_false(pktlen < sizeof(struct ieee80211_frame_ack) || in rtwn_pci_rx_frame()
118 pktlen > MJUMPAGESIZE)) { in rtwn_pci_rx_frame()
120 "%s: frame is too short/long: %d\n", __func__, pktlen); in rtwn_pci_rx_frame()
154 m->m_pkthdr.len = m->m_len = pktlen + infosz + shift; in rtwn_pci_rx_frame()
160 __func__, pktlen, infosz, shift); in rtwn_pci_rx_frame()
186 int desc_size, pktlen; in rtwn_pci_rx_buf_copy() local
199 pktlen = MS(rxdw0, RTWN_RXDW0_PKTLEN); in rtwn_pci_rx_buf_copy()
201 if (pktlen > sizeof(pc->pc_rx_buf) - desc_size) in rtwn_pci_rx_buf_copy()
[all …]
H A Drtwn_pci_tx.c132 txd->pktlen = htole16(m->m_pkthdr.len); in rtwn_pci_tx_start_frame()
220 if (!own || txd->pktlen != htole16(m->m_pkthdr.len)) { in rtwn_pci_tx_start_beacon()
239 txd->pktlen = htole16(m->m_pkthdr.len); in rtwn_pci_tx_start_beacon()
/freebsd/sys/dev/rtwn/usb/
H A Drtwn_usb_rx.c72 int pktlen; in rtwn_rx_check_pre_alloc() local
95 pktlen = MS(rxdw0, RTWN_RXDW0_PKTLEN); in rtwn_rx_check_pre_alloc()
96 if (__predict_false(pktlen < sizeof(struct ieee80211_frame_ack))) { in rtwn_rx_check_pre_alloc()
101 "%s: frame is too short: %d\n", __func__, pktlen); in rtwn_rx_check_pre_alloc()
157 int totlen, pktlen, infosz, min_len; in rtwn_rxeof_fragmented() local
186 pktlen = MS(rxdw0, RTWN_RXDW0_PKTLEN); in rtwn_rxeof_fragmented()
188 totlen = sizeof(*stat) + infosz + pktlen; in rtwn_rxeof_fragmented()
244 int totlen, pktlen, infosz; in rtwn_rxeof() local
257 pktlen = MS(rxdw0, RTWN_RXDW0_PKTLEN); in rtwn_rxeof()
258 if (__predict_false(pktlen == 0)) in rtwn_rxeof()
[all …]
/freebsd/sys/dev/ath/
H A Dif_ath_tx_ht.c405 uint16_t pktlen, int is_first) in ath_compute_num_delims() argument
443 ndelim = ATH_AGGR_GET_NDELIM(pktlen); in ath_compute_num_delims()
478 __func__, pktlen, ndelim, mpdudensity); in ath_compute_num_delims()
519 if (pktlen < minlen) { in ath_compute_num_delims()
520 mindelim = (minlen - pktlen) / ATH_AGGR_DELIM_SZ; in ath_compute_num_delims()
526 __func__, pktlen, minlen, rix, rc, width, half_gi, ndelim); in ath_compute_num_delims()
622 int pktlen; in ath_rateseries_setup() local
634 pktlen = bf->bf_state.bfs_al; in ath_rateseries_setup()
636 pktlen = bf->bf_state.bfs_pktlen; in ath_rateseries_setup()
698 ath_computedur_ht(pktlen in ath_rateseries_setup()
[all …]
/freebsd/contrib/unbound/sldns/
H A Dwire2str.h165 size_t* str_len, uint8_t* pkt, size_t pktlen, int* comprloop);
180 size_t* str_len, uint8_t* pkt, size_t pktlen, int* comprloop);
195 size_t* str_len, uint8_t* pkt, size_t pktlen, int* comprloop);
240 size_t* str_len, uint16_t rrtype, uint8_t* pkt, size_t pktlen,
274 size_t* str_len, uint8_t* pkt, size_t pktlen, int* comprloop);
526 size_t* str_len, int rdftype, uint8_t* pkt, size_t pktlen,
829 size_t* str_len, uint8_t* pkt, size_t pktlen, int* comprloop);
1060 size_t* str_len, uint8_t* pkt, size_t pktlen);
H A Dwire2str.c441 size_t pktlen = *dlen; in sldns_wire2str_pkt_scan() local
455 pkt, pktlen, &comprloop); in sldns_wire2str_pkt_scan()
461 w += sldns_wire2str_rr_scan(d, dlen, s, slen, pkt, pktlen, &comprloop); in sldns_wire2str_pkt_scan()
467 w += sldns_wire2str_rr_scan(d, dlen, s, slen, pkt, pktlen, &comprloop); in sldns_wire2str_pkt_scan()
473 w += sldns_wire2str_rr_scan(d, dlen, s, slen, pkt, pktlen, &comprloop); in sldns_wire2str_pkt_scan()
477 w += sldns_str_print(s, slen, ";; MSG SIZE rcvd: %d\n", (int)pktlen); in sldns_wire2str_pkt_scan()
522 uint8_t* pkt, size_t pktlen, int* comprloop) in sldns_wire2str_rr_scan() argument
532 return sldns_wire2str_edns_scan(d, dlen, s, slen, pkt, pktlen); in sldns_wire2str_rr_scan()
537 w += sldns_wire2str_dname_scan(d, dlen, s, slen, pkt, pktlen, comprloop); in sldns_wire2str_rr_scan()
581 w += sldns_wire2str_rdata_scan(d, &rdlen, s, slen, rrtype, pkt, pktlen, in sldns_wire2str_rr_scan()
[all …]
/freebsd/libexec/bootpd/
H A Dbootpd.c143 int pktlen; variable
550 pktlen = n; in main()
1102 if (sendto(s, pktbuf, pktlen, 0, in sendreply()
1232 pktlen = hp->msg_size; in dovend_rfc1048()
1239 if (pktlen > sizeof(*bp)) { in dovend_rfc1048()
1241 report(LOG_INFO, "request message length=%d", pktlen); in dovend_rfc1048()
1283 pktlen = msgsz - BP_MSG_OVERHEAD; in dovend_rfc1048()
1288 if (pktlen < sizeof(*bp)) { in dovend_rfc1048()
1289 report(LOG_ERR, "invalid response length=%d", pktlen); in dovend_rfc1048()
1290 pktlen = sizeof(*bp); in dovend_rfc1048()
[all …]
/freebsd/usr.sbin/bhyve/
H A Dnet_backend_slirp.c566 size_t pktlen; in slirp_send() local
568 pktlen = 0; in slirp_send()
570 pktlen += iov[i].iov_len; in slirp_send()
571 pkt = malloc(pktlen); in slirp_send()
574 pktlen = 0; in slirp_send()
576 memcpy(pkt + pktlen, iov[i].iov_base, iov[i].iov_len); in slirp_send()
577 pktlen += iov[i].iov_len; in slirp_send()
580 slirp_input_p(priv->slirp, pkt, (int)pktlen); in slirp_send()
583 return (pktlen); in slirp_send()
/freebsd/sys/net/
H A Ddebugnet.c265 uint32_t i, pktlen, sent_so_far; in debugnet_send() local
279 pktlen = datalen - sent_so_far; in debugnet_send()
282 pktlen = min(pktlen, pcb->dp_ifp->if_mtu - in debugnet_send()
290 sent_so_far += pktlen; in debugnet_send()
309 dn_msg_hdr->mh_len = htonl(pktlen); in debugnet_send()
320 if (pktlen != 0) { in debugnet_send()
328 pktlen, debugnet_mbuf_free, NULL, NULL, 0, in debugnet_send()
330 m2->m_len = pktlen; in debugnet_send()
333 m->m_pkthdr.len += pktlen; in debugnet_send()
341 sent_so_far += pktlen; in debugnet_send()
H A Dbpf.c2300 bpf_tap(struct bpf_if *bp, u_char *pkt, u_int pktlen) in bpf_tap() argument
2324 slen = (*(bf->func))(pkt, pktlen, pktlen); in bpf_tap()
2327 slen = bpf_filter(d->bd_rfilter, pkt, pktlen, pktlen); in bpf_tap()
2340 catchpacket(d, pkt, pktlen, slen, in bpf_tap()
2349 bpf_tap_if(if_t ifp, u_char *pkt, u_int pktlen) in bpf_tap_if() argument
2352 bpf_tap(ifp->if_bpf, pkt, pktlen); in bpf_tap_if()
2372 u_int pktlen, slen; in bpf_mtap() local
2381 pktlen = m_length(m, NULL); in bpf_mtap()
2393 slen = (*(bf->func))(mtod(m, u_char *), pktlen, in bpf_mtap()
2394 pktlen); in bpf_mtap()
[all …]
H A Ddebugnet_inet.c235 int pktlen; in debugnet_send_arp() local
246 pktlen = arphdr_len2(ETHER_ADDR_LEN, sizeof(struct in_addr)); in debugnet_send_arp()
247 m->m_len = pktlen; in debugnet_send_arp()
248 m->m_pkthdr.len = pktlen; in debugnet_send_arp()
249 MH_ALIGN(m, pktlen); in debugnet_send_arp()
/freebsd/sys/netgraph/
H A Dng_tcpmss.c277 int iphlen, tcphlen, pktlen; in ng_tcpmss_rcvdata() local
288 pktlen = m->m_pkthdr.len; in ng_tcpmss_rcvdata()
289 priv->stats.Octets += pktlen; in ng_tcpmss_rcvdata()
315 if (iphlen < sizeof(struct ip) || iphlen > pktlen ) in ng_tcpmss_rcvdata()
329 if (tcphlen < sizeof(struct tcphdr) || tcphlen > pktlen - iphlen) in ng_tcpmss_rcvdata()
/freebsd/sys/dev/hyperv/vmbus/
H A Dvmbus_chan.c1089 int pktlen, pad_pktlen, hlen, error; in vmbus_chan_send()
1095 pktlen = hlen + dlen; in vmbus_chan_send()
1096 pad_pktlen = VMBUS_CHANPKT_TOTLEN(pktlen); in vmbus_chan_send()
1111 iov[2].iov_len = pad_pktlen - pktlen; in vmbus_chan_send()
1124 int pktlen, pad_pktlen, hlen, error; in vmbus_chan_send_sglist()
1130 pktlen = hlen + dlen; in vmbus_chan_send_sglist()
1131 pad_pktlen = VMBUS_CHANPKT_TOTLEN(pktlen); in vmbus_chan_send_sglist()
1150 iov[3].iov_len = pad_pktlen - pktlen; in vmbus_chan_send_sglist()
1164 int pktlen, pad_pktlen, hlen, error; in vmbus_chan_send_prplist()
1171 pktlen in vmbus_chan_send_prplist()
1091 int pktlen, pad_pktlen, hlen, error; vmbus_chan_send() local
1126 int pktlen, pad_pktlen, hlen, error; vmbus_chan_send_sglist() local
1166 int pktlen, pad_pktlen, hlen, error; vmbus_chan_send_prplist() local
1251 int error, pktlen, pkt_hlen; vmbus_chan_recv_pkt() local
[all...]
/freebsd/sys/netpfil/ipfw/
H A Dip_fw2.c1434 int pktlen; in ipfw_chk() local
1474 pktlen = IPFW_ARGS_LENGTH(args->flags); in ipfw_chk()
1492 pktlen = m->m_pkthdr.len; in ipfw_chk()
1513 if (__predict_false(pktlen < x)) { \ in ipfw_chk()
1550 if (pktlen >= sizeof(struct ip6_hdr) && in ipfw_chk()
1578 if (pktlen >= hlen + sizeof(struct sctphdr) + in ipfw_chk()
1585 else if (pktlen >= hlen + sizeof(struct sctphdr)) in ipfw_chk()
1586 PULLUP_LEN(hlen, ulp, pktlen - hlen); in ipfw_chk()
1742 } else if (pktlen >= sizeof(struct ip) && in ipfw_chk()
1769 if (pktlen >= hlen + sizeof(struct sctphdr) + in ipfw_chk()
[all …]
H A Dip_fw_dynamic.c117 #define DYN_COUNTER_INC(d, dir, pktlen) do { \ argument
119 (d)->bcnt_ ## dir += pktlen; \
1005 const void *ulp, int pktlen, int dir) in dyn_update_proto_state() argument
1029 DYN_COUNTER_INC(data, fwd, pktlen); in dyn_update_proto_state()
1031 DYN_COUNTER_INC(data, rev, pktlen); in dyn_update_proto_state()
1040 struct ipfw_dyn_info *info, int pktlen) in dyn_lookup_ipv4_state() argument
1070 dyn_update_proto_state(s->data, pkt, ulp, pktlen, in dyn_lookup_ipv4_state()
1081 const void *ulp, int pktlen, uint32_t bucket, uint16_t kidx) in dyn_lookup_ipv4_state_locked() argument
1105 dyn_update_proto_state(s->data, pkt, ulp, pktlen, dir); in dyn_lookup_ipv4_state_locked()
1187 const void *ulp, struct ipfw_dyn_info *info, int pktlen) in dyn_lookup_ipv6_state() argument
[all …]
H A Dip_fw_bpf.c141 ipfw_bpf_tap(u_char *pkt, u_int pktlen) in ipfw_bpf_tap() argument
147 BPF_TAP(ifp, pkt, pktlen); in ipfw_bpf_tap()
/freebsd/sys/dev/hyperv/include/
H A Dvmbus.h76 #define VMBUS_CHANPKT_GETLEN(pktlen) \ argument
77 (((int)(pktlen)) << VMBUS_CHANPKT_SIZE_SHIFT)
206 struct vmbus_chanpkt_hdr *pkt, int *pktlen);
/freebsd/sys/dev/rtwn/rtl8192c/pci/
H A Dr92ce_tx.c74 txd->txbufsize = txd->pktlen; in r92ce_tx_postsetup()
103 __func__, le16toh(txd->pktlen), txd->offset, txd->flags0, in r92ce_dump_tx_desc()
/freebsd/libexec/bootpd/bootpgw/
H A Dbootpgw.c124 int pktlen; variable
465 pktlen = n; in main()
587 if (sendto(s, pktbuf, pktlen, 0, in handle_request()
656 if (sendto(s, pktbuf, pktlen, 0, in handle_reply()
/freebsd/tests/sys/netinet/
H A Dip_reass_test.c79 size_t pktlen; in alloc_lopacket() local
81 pktlen = sizeof(*packet) + payloadlen; in alloc_lopacket()
82 packet = malloc(pktlen); in alloc_lopacket()
85 memset(packet, 0, pktlen); in alloc_lopacket()
/freebsd/sys/dev/cxgbe/crypto/
H A Dt6_kern_tls.c1117 int len16, ndesc, pktlen; in ktls_write_tcp_options() local
1128 pktlen = m->m_len; in ktls_write_tcp_options()
1129 ctrl = sizeof(struct cpl_tx_pkt_core) + pktlen; in ktls_write_tcp_options()
1147 cpl->len = htobe16(pktlen); in ktls_write_tcp_options()
1159 newip.ip_len = htons(pktlen - m->m_pkthdr.l2hlen); in ktls_write_tcp_options()
1170 newip6.ip6_plen = htons(pktlen - m->m_pkthdr.l2hlen); in ktls_write_tcp_options()
1187 copy_to_txd(&txq->eq, (caddr_t)(tcp + 1), &out, pktlen - in ktls_write_tcp_options()
1211 int len16, ndesc, pktlen; in ktls_write_tunnel_packet() local
1228 pktlen = m->m_len + m_tls->m_len; in ktls_write_tunnel_packet()
1229 ctrl = sizeof(struct cpl_tx_pkt_core) + pktlen; in ktls_write_tunnel_packet()
1859 int len16, ndesc, pktlen; ktls_write_tcp_fin() local
[all...]

1234